Имя: Пароль:
1C
1С v8
Зарплата и кадры 2.5 Ошибка "Не удалось сформировать внешнюю печатную форму!"
,
0 Новичок78
 
08.04.15
09:23
"Не удалось сформировать внешнюю печатную форму!
Значение не является значением объектного типа (Организация)" -  в одной программе обработка работает в двух других нет, конфигурация, платформа на всех трех одинаковая, почему ?
1 User_Agronom
 
08.04.15
09:24
Кэш чистили?
2 piter3
 
08.04.15
09:28
(0)не верю
3 Einzelhaft
 
08.04.15
09:31
Может в одной конфе организация по умолчанию у пользователя заполнена, а в двух других нет.
4 User_Agronom
 
08.04.15
09:35
(2) Верю. Может организация берется как реквизит одного из реквизитов объекта, а этот реквизит не заполнен.
5 piter3
 
08.04.15
09:36
(4) может не может это не наше.пусть код показывает,зачем гадать
6 User_Agronom
 
08.04.15
09:40
(5) Сейчас выкатит 100500 строк кода))
7 piter3
 
08.04.15
09:41
(6) ненене только с ошибкой.
8 User_Agronom
 
08.04.15
10:11
(7) Если ТС не настолько робок, что боится открыть конфигуратор, да ещё найдёт строки с ошибкой - то тему можно закрывать: разберётся сам.
9 Новичок78
 
08.04.15
10:14
Вот где выдает ошибку:

Функция СформироватьЗапросДляПечати(Режим)

    Запрос = Новый Запрос;

    // Установим параметры запроса
    Запрос.УстановитьПараметр("ДокументСсылка",    СсылкаНаОбъект);
    Запрос.УстановитьПараметр("ДатаДокумента",    СсылкаНаОбъект.Дата);

    Если Режим = "ПоРеквизитамДокумента" Тогда

        Запрос.МенеджерВременныхТаблиц = Новый МенеджерВременныхТаблиц;
        Запрос.УстановитьПараметр("СтруктурнаяЕдиница",СсылкаНаОбъект.Организация);
        
        Запрос.Текст = ФормированиеПечатныхФормЗК.ПолучитьТекстЗапросаПоОтветственнымЛицам(
            "ДатаДокумента",
            "ОтветственноеЛицо = ЗНАЧЕНИЕ(Перечисление.ОтветственныеЛицаОрганизаций.Руководитель)
            |И СтруктурнаяЕдиница = &СтруктурнаяЕдиница");
        Запрос.Выполнить();
10 piter3
 
08.04.15
10:16
СсылкаНаОбъект это что в базе с ошибкой?документ подозреваю или сотр?
11 IBTM
 
08.04.15
13:00
(10) судя по СсылкаНаОбъект.Дата, это документ.
(9) так а где конкретно затык?
12 Einzelhaft
 
08.04.15
13:08
А есть ли Организация у документа из которого эту внешнюю печатную форму открывают, (который СсылкаНаОбъект) и не тип ли строка(или что то наподобие - кроме документ того типа из которого печатают) у самого этого реквизита?
AdBlock убивает бесплатный контент. 1Сергей